Quick answer

Dadrora is a village in Sagwara Tehsil of Dungarpur district in Rajasthan. Its Census location code is 098134.

About Dadrora village record

The source record places Dadrora in Sagwara Tehsil of Dungarpur district, Rajasthan. Its Census village code is 098134.

The Census 2011 record reports population 755, 146 households, area 275.82 hectares, PIN code 314035.
